A consortium of business partners led by real estate billionaire Arthur G Cohen, Adi Cohen and Joseph Grinkorn of Killer Films owners GC Venture Capital Fund's, Baldwin Entertainment's Howard and Karen Baldwin and City Lights Media are launching the East Coast studio United Studios Of America.

The group is expected to invest hundreds of millions of dollars in the venture and the partners are scouting for a 500-acre lot in New York, Connecticut, Rhode Island, Massachusetts and other Eastern States offering tax breaks.

A Searle Field has been named chief executive of the new development, which it is understood will feature cutting edge energy and environmental design and encompass upscale hotel, resort and residential plots in the surrounding vicinity.

The group's steering committee is already in talks with officials from the aforementioned States and sources said production at the films and television studios was projected to get underway as early as February.
